Sat 1268103106519252

decimal
297241.606519252
degree
0°87241′889″606519252‴
percentile
60.385862281626956%
name
eweqfycpogz
cycle
0
epoch
1
period
147
block
297241
offset
606519252
timestamp
rarity
common